Help bring a smile to a child and family's face! If you live on the island or are coming down to visit before January 1st, please consider making a donation to the Three King's Day project.
Started several years ago by long time resident Susan Bonnett, who passed away earlier this year, the volunteers for the Three Kings project join together to distribute toys, food packages, toothbrushes, toothpaste and dental floss to those who might otherwise go without.
The volunteers do their best to provide something for everyone: babies, toddlers, school age children, even moms and dads; and they can use your help.
